Henley Executive seeks a Recruitment Consultant to join their growing team in Henley-In-Arden. This full-time on-site role requires managing the entire recruitment process, consulting with clients, sourcing candidates, and providing tailored solutions.
Successful candidates will leverage their 360 recruiting experience, strong interviewing skills, and ability to foster client relationships.
A competitive salary of £26,000 - £35,000 DOE plus commission is offered. Applicants must include their location in their CV when applying.
